mkYesodDispatch "App" resourcesApp
makeFoundation :: AppSettings -> IO App
makeFoundation appSettings = do
appAWSEnv <- newAWSEnv $ appSettings `allowsLevel` LevelDebug
appHttpManager <- newManager
appLogger <- newStdoutLoggerSet defaultBufSize >>= makeYesodLogger
appStatic <-
(if appMutableStatic appSettings then staticDevel else static)
(appStaticDir appSettings)
-- Bootstrap a log function to use when creating the connection pool
let mkFoundation appConnPool = App{..}
tempFoundation = mkFoundation $ error "connPool forced in tempFoundation"
logFunc = messageLoggerSource tempFoundation appLogger
pool <- flip runLoggingT logFunc $ createPostgresqlPool
(pgConnStr $ appDatabaseConf appSettings)
(pgPoolSize $ appDatabaseConf appSettings)
-- Perform database migrations
runLoggingT (runSqlPool (runMigration migrateAll) pool) logFunc
-- Output settings at startup
runLoggingT ($(logInfo) $ "settings " <> T.pack (show appSettings)) logFunc
return $ mkFoundation pool
where
newAWSEnv debug = AWS.configure (appS3Service appSettings) <$> do
logger <- AWS.newLogger (if debug then AWS.Debug else AWS.Error) stdout
set AWS.envLogger logger <$> AWS.newEnv AWS.Discover
makeApplication :: App -> IO Application
makeApplication foundation = do
logWare <- makeLogWare foundation
appPlain <- toWaiAppPlain foundation
return $ logWare $ defaultMiddlewaresNoLogging appPlain
makeLogWare :: App -> IO Middleware
makeLogWare foundation = mkRequestLogger def
{ outputFormat = if appSettings foundation `allowsLevel` LevelDebug
then Detailed True
else Apache apacheIpSource
, destination = if appSettings foundation `allowsLevel` LevelInfo
then Logger $ loggerSet $ appLogger foundation
else Callback $ \_ -> return ()
}
where
apacheIpSource = if appIpFromHeader $ appSettings foundation
then FromFallback
else FromSocket
warpSettings :: App -> Settings
warpSettings foundation =
setPort (appPort $ appSettings foundation) $
setHost (appHost $ appSettings foundation) $
setOnException (\_req e ->
when (defaultShouldDisplayException e) $ messageLoggerSource
foundation
(appLogger foundation)
$(qLocation >>= liftLoc)
"yesod"
LevelError
(toLogStr $ "Exception from Warp: " ++ show e))
defaultSettings
getAppSettings :: IO AppSettings
getAppSettings = do
loadEnv
loadYamlSettings [configSettingsYml] [] useEnv
develMain :: IO ()
develMain = develMainHelper $ do
settings <- getAppSettings
foundation <- makeFoundation settings
wsettings <- getDevSettings $ warpSettings foundation
app <- makeApplication foundation
return (wsettings, app)
appMain :: IO ()
appMain = do
settings <- getAppSettings
foundation <- makeFoundation settings
app <- makeApplication foundation
runSettings (warpSettings foundation) app
